Honey is globally recognized for its substantial nutritional and therapeutic properties. However, its high market value makes it susceptible to counterfeiting, negatively impacting consumers and beekeepers. This paper presents a blockchain-based framework to monitor the honey trade supply chain, ensuring authenticity. The framework employs an oracle component to verify honey quality and origin using IoT data. Additionally, it integrates fungible and non-fungible tokens to track honey batches. The study evaluates the economic feasibility of this approach, demonstrating that the cost of performing a trade is less than USD 1, with the oracle component achieving an average accuracy rate of 90% in detecting falsified sensor data.

In recent years, much more attention has been devoted to the management of honey bees, resulting in the slowing down of bee mortality and their improved protection. However, there are still some obstacles that prevent all-encompassing protection. In this work, we present the first prototype of a system that the processes of a supply chain of apiarists by enabling them to sell the products on a blockchain platform, thus preserving the provenance of the product. The data is processed in the context of smart contracts, which provide a majority of the business logic of how the data can/may be processed and accessed. We give an overview of the background of the usefulness of the proposed solution in regard to the recognized issues in this field. Further, we demonstrate the first approaches that have been implemented in order to lay a solid cornerstone for supporting beekeepers with a decentralized system. The code for the prototype application is available on GitHub.
Purpose -The increase in the popularity of cryptocurrency market, various literature figure out the macroeconomic factors that effect the price movements of cryptocurrencies. This research aims to identify the interaction between gold, brent oil and bitcoin. Methodology -The database includes the Daily prices of Bitcoin, gold and brent oil prices between the period of 28.04.2013-23.07.2019 which consist of 484 daily data. Natural logaritm for each indicator is used. First, the stationarity of the series were analyzed with ADF (Augmented Dickey Fuller) unit root test. Lag lengths are determined. Interactions between the series were analyzed by the Impulse-Response Function and Variance Decomposition methods. Findings-The series are found out to be stationary at first difference. Impulse response graphs indicate that all variables respond in a reducing way to reducing shocks occurred in each indicator. Shocks have lost their effect on average in 5 days.
Bitcoin is a virtual currency that is created from computer code. It has no central bank and is not backed by any government. But it can be exchanged for goods and services or for any other currencies. They were launched in 2009 as a bit of software written under the name Satoshi Nakamoto. The present paper analyse the Indian Tax and legal considerations regarding Bit coins. It also analyse the problems and risks related with Bitcoins.
